A lidar mapping robot vacuum uses lasers to draw an internal map of your home. It is more precise than systems using gyroscopes and allows you to mark off areas for mopping.

The vacuum is able to clean more efficiently and safely by using the map it generates. This reduces the chance of collision and conserves energy.

Accuracy

lidar vacuum robot is utilized by many robot vacuums with lidar vacuum cleaners in order to improve navigation. It operates by sending the laser out and observing the time it takes the light to reflect off objects and then return to the sensor itself. This information is used to calculate the distance of an object. It is a more precise way to measure the position of a robot than traditional GPS that requires an accurate view of the environment. It is especially suitable for large spaces with complicated furniture or layouts.

In addition to mapping, lidar can also detect the shape of objects and their location which is crucial for robots to avoid collisions. However it is important to know that lidar isn't without its limitations. One limitation is that it cannot detect surfaces with a reflective or transparent surface, such as glass coffee tables. The robot may cause damage to the table if it moves through the table due to the error. Manufacturers can overcome this limitation by increasing the sensitivity of lidar explained sensors or by combining them with cameras and bumper sensors to enhance navigation and mapping.

Robots with mapping capabilities are able to navigate more accurately and plan routes to avoid obstacles in real-time. They can also determine the best route to take when they are low on energy and need to recharge their dock. They can also utilize their maps to determine the most efficient method to clean up an area without missing any areas.

This technology is a step up over the traditional mapping using cameras that makes use of digital cameras to record landmarks within the home. This method is effective however, it can only work when the robot has access to an external source of light. This can be a problem in dark rooms, where the camera is unable to function properly. However, robots with mapping capabilities can create digital maps of your home by using a variety of sensors to detect furniture and walls. This data is then processed to create a cleaning path that will minimize damage and ensure that all areas are cleaned.

Reliability

Unlike traditional robot vacuums that rely on sensors like bumper and cliff sensors mapping robots use camera, laser or infrared to scan the environment and find landmarks. The robot is then able to plan and plan its cleaning route by using the digital map. Map-making robots can also identify dirt and other particles which makes them more efficient in cleaning.

The ECOVACS MagSlim LiDAR navigation robot is a robust robot that utilizes three different mapping techniques to make sure that your home is thoroughly cleaned. Its accuracy is higher than VSLAM or gyroscope technology and it can measure to millimeters. This mapping technology is extremely efficient in navigating complicated home layouts and can help avoid obstructing objects.

A lidar mapping robot employs an invisible spinning laser to scan its surroundings, measuring the time it takes for the laser to bounce off of surrounding walls and reflect back onto itself. The sensors calculate the distance between each object, and then create a 3D image of the space. This information enables the robot to build an precise and efficient mapping system, ensuring that every inch of your home is covered.

Some models, such as the Neato XV11, use cameras to detect the edges of furniture or other obstructions. This method of navigation works for rooms that have a clear layout however it isn't always easy to navigate in dark areas or when there are many small objects.

Alternatively it is the Dreame F9 features 14 infrared sensors that allow the robot to avoid objects and obstacles. The sensors work with the dToF LiDAR sensor, allowing the robot to find its way even in dark or cluttered rooms. Additionally, the sensors can detect carpeted areas and automatically increase suction power to ensure maximum performance.

A drop detector for a robot vacuum is essential since it protects the device from falling down stairs or other large differences in levels. It's a handy addition, because it prevents you from having to clean up spills that happen. Additionally, it will prevent the robot from hitting objects or slipping over its own legs while moving.

Cost

Many robot vacuums utilize several sensors to navigate your home and ensure that all corners are clean. They also can tell you the condition of their batteries, and when it's time to recharge. The top robotic vacuums feature advanced mapping technology that allows for a more accurate and efficient cleaning. These machines make use of laser and optical sensors to map out the layout of the room and map out its route systematically and efficiently, which makes them more effective than traditional navigation systems.

LiDAR technology, also known as Light Detection And Ranging, is utilized by the most advanced mapping robots. This system was originally developed specifically for the aerospace industry. It sends an arc of light in the infrared range and records the time it takes to reach an object. The data is used to create a digital three-dimensional map of the surrounding environment. This map can help the robot avoid obstacles and find its way around the house without getting lost. Some models show their digital maps on the app, so you can see what they've been doing.

Another type of mapping system is gyroscope-based which calculates distance and direction using accelerometer sensors. These sensors aren't as precise as lidar sensors, but are still useful for basic navigation. Some robots make use of a mix of different mapping techniques, and some combine LiDAR with other sensors to provide more efficient navigation.

An excellent example is the EcoVACS DEEBOT with Truemapping technology, which uses LiDAR and other sensors to examine your home and find obstacles. The technology for smart map planning allows the DEEBOT to vacuum your entire home in just under an hour. This saves you time to do other tasks. The sensor's intelligence can recognize carpet areas and increase suction power automatically. You can set virtual boundaries within the ECOVACS App to prevent the robot from certain rooms or objects. And with anti-drop sensors, the ECOVACS DEEBOT is able to safely navigate the stairs. It also works with voice assistants such as Siri and Alexa to provide hands-free control.
